Frequently asked questions

How do I set up my Scan Card?
After delivery, follow the included instructions to link the card to your Google review page. You do not need to send us your business details when ordering.
What happens when a customer taps or scans?
Their phone opens the Google review page linked to your card. NFC provides the tap option, while the printed QR code provides a camera-based alternative.
Does the customer need a Scan Cards app?
No Scan Cards app is needed. Google may ask the customer to sign in to a Google Account before submitting a review.
Will it work with iPhone and Android?
It works with most modern NFC-enabled smartphones. If NFC is unavailable, the customer can scan the QR code instead.
